////////// Document
/// <summary>
/// Indicates the type of content and thus which pipeline will process the file.
/// </summary>
/// <remarks>
/// This will be automatically set based on the media type of the file and other metadata,
/// but it can be further adjusted by setting manually. For example, if you have a ".cshtml"
/// file but you want to copy it to the output folder instead of processing as a Razor file,
/// set the <see cref="ContentType"/> to <see cref="ContentType.Asset"/>.
/// </remarks>
public const string ContentType = nameof(ContentType);
/// <summary>
/// Changes the media type of the document (normally this is interpreted from the file extension).
/// </summary>
/// <remarks>
/// For example, to force script evaluation for a file that isn't ".cs" or ".csx", set the
/// <see cref="MediaType"/> front matter to <see cref="MediaTypes.CSharp"/>.
/// </remarks>
public const string MediaType = nameof(MediaType);
/// <summary>
/// Set to <c>true</c> to indicate that the content contains a script that should be evaluated before processing normally.
/// </summary>
public const string Script = nameof(Script);
/// <summary>
/// Indicates that if a script file has a second extension such as "foo.md.csx" that the script extension should be removed
/// and the preceding extension should be used to reset the media type after script evaluation, and thus the templates that
/// will be executed (the default is <c>true</c>).
/// </summary>
public const string RemoveScriptExtension = nameof(RemoveScriptExtension);
/// <summary>
/// The title of the document, often used by themes.
/// </summary>
public const string Title = nameof(Title);
/// <summary>
/// The description of the document, often used by themes.
/// </summary>
public const string Description = nameof(Description);
/// <summary>
/// The author of the site, post, or page (can be set at any level).
/// </summary>
public const string Author = nameof(Author);
public const string Image = nameof(Image);
public const string Copyright = nameof(Copyright);
/// <summary>
/// The date the file or post was published.
/// </summary>
/// <remarks>
/// If you want to use a different metadata key to represent published dates you can
/// globally fetch a value from a different key by setting <see cref="Published"/>
/// in settings to an evaluated metadata script like <c>=> SomeOtherKey</c>.
/// The pipelines will ensure that the <see cref="Published"/> value is always set by
/// either reading from an existing value or by attempting to determine a published
/// date using the file name or (optionally) the file last modified time.
/// </remarks>
public const string Published = nameof(Published);
public const string PublishedUsesLastModifiedDate = nameof(PublishedUsesLastModifiedDate);
public const string Updated = nameof(Updated);
/// <summary>
/// Indicates the document should be excluded from pipeline processing if <c>true</c>.
/// The default value looks at <see cref="Published"/>
/// and filters out any future-dated content or data, though you can also define a value
/// for this setting directly for each document.
/// </summary>
public const string Excluded = nameof(Excluded);
/// <summary>
/// Indicates that the file should be output.
/// By default content and asset files are output and data files are not.
/// </summary>
public const string ShouldOutput = nameof(ShouldOutput);
/// <summary>
/// Set this to <c>true</c> to clear the content of data files after processing (the default is <c>false</c>).
/// </summary>
public const string ClearDataContent = nameof(ClearDataContent);
/// <summary>
/// Indicates the layout file that should be used for this document (used by the Razor template engine).
/// </summary>
public const string Layout = nameof(Layout);
/// <summary>
/// Specifies the cross-reference ID of the current document. If not explicitly provided, it will default
/// to the title of the document with spaces replaced by underscores (which is derived from the source file name
/// if no <see cref="Title"/> metadata is defined for the document).
/// </summary>
public const string Xref = nameof(Xref);
/// <summary>
/// Used with directory metadata to indicate if the metadata should be applied
/// recursively to files in child directories (the default is <c>true</c>).
/// </summary>
public const string Recursive = nameof(Recursive);
/// <summary>
/// Indicates that post-process templates should be rendered (the default is <c>true</c>).
/// </summary>
/// <remarks>
/// Set this to <c>false</c> for a document to prevent rendering post-process templates such as Razor.
/// This can be helpful when you have small bits of content like Markdown that you want to render
/// as HTML but not as an entire page so that it can be included in other pages.
/// </remarks>
public const string RenderPostProcessTemplates = nameof(RenderPostProcessTemplates);
////////// Archive
/// <summary>
/// The pipeline(s) to get documents for the archive from.
/// Defaults to the <c>Content</c> pipeline if not defined.
/// </summary>
public const string ArchivePipelines = nameof(ArchivePipelines);
/// <summary>
/// A globbing pattern to filter documents from the
/// archive pipeline(s) based on source path (or all documents from the pipeline(s) if not defined).
/// </summary>
public const string ArchiveSources = nameof(ArchiveSources);
/// <summary>
/// An additional metadata filter for documents from the
/// archive pipeline(s) that should return a <c>bool</c>.
/// </summary>
public const string ArchiveFilter = nameof(ArchiveFilter);
/// <summary>
/// The key to use for generating archive groups. The
/// source documents will be grouped by the key value(s).
/// This can either be the name of a metadata key to use
/// or a computed value that will get archive key values.
/// If this is not defined, only a single archive index
/// with the source documents will be generated.
/// </summary>
public const string ArchiveKey = nameof(ArchiveKey);
/// <summary>
/// An <c>IEqualityComparer&lt;object&gt;</c> to use for comparing archive groups.
/// </summary>
/// <remarks>
/// A scripted metadata value can be used to return the appropriate comparer and
/// the <see cref="IEqualityComparerExtensions.ToConvertingEqualityComparer{T}(IEqualityComparer{T})"/> extension method
/// can be used to convert a typed comparer into a <c>IEqualityComparer&lt;object&gt;</c>.
/// For example, to ignore case when generating an archive for tags, you can use
/// <c>ArchiveKeyComparer: => StringComparer.OrdinalIgnoreCase.ToConvertingEqualityComparer()</c>.
/// </remarks>
public const string ArchiveKeyComparer = nameof(ArchiveKeyComparer);
/// <summary>
/// The number of items on each group page (or all group items if not defined).
/// </summary>
/// <remarks>
/// The current page index is stored in the <c>Index</c> metadata value.
/// </remarks>
public const string ArchivePageSize = nameof(ArchivePageSize);
/// <summary>
/// The title of each group output document.
/// </summary>
/// <remarks>
/// This is usually a computed value (starting with a
/// <c>=&gt;</c>) that calculates the title based
/// on the group key. If this value is not specified, the
/// default title will be "[Archive Title] - [Group Key] (Page [Index (If Paged)])".
/// </remarks>
public const string ArchiveTitle = nameof(ArchiveTitle);
/// <summary>
/// The destination path of each group output document.
/// </summary>
/// <remarks>
/// This is usually a computed value (starting with a
/// <c>=&gt;</c>) that calculates the destination based
/// on the group key. If this value is not specified, the
/// default group destination will be
/// "[Archive File Path]/[Archive File Name]/[Group Key]/[Index (If Paged)].html".
/// The destination path of the archive index follows
/// normal destination calculation and will be placed at
/// the same relative path as the archive file or can be
/// changed with metadata like <c>DestinationPath</c>.
/// </remarks>
public const string ArchiveDestination = nameof(ArchiveDestination);
/// <summary>
/// A metadata key that contains the value that sorting should be based on.
/// </summary>
/// <remarks>
/// If both <see cref="ArchiveOrder"/> and <see cref="ArchiveOrderKey"/> are specified,
/// <see cref="ArchiveOrderKey"/> will be applied first followed by <see cref="ArchiveOrder"/>.
/// </remarks>
public const string ArchiveOrderKey = nameof(ArchiveOrderKey);
/// <summary>
/// A value that sorting should be based on (I.e. using a computed value).
/// </summary>
/// <remarks>
/// If both <see cref="ArchiveOrder"/> and <see cref="ArchiveOrderKey"/> are specified,
/// <see cref="ArchiveOrderKey"/> will be applied first followed by <see cref="ArchiveOrder"/>.
/// </remarks>
public const string ArchiveOrder = nameof(ArchiveOrder);
/// <summary>
/// Indicates the archive should be sorted in descending order.
/// </summary>
public const string ArchiveOrderDescending = nameof(ArchiveOrderDescending);
